Break-glass access: Murmuret log sampling. Murmuret is chatty; we sample at 2% in prod. During incidents, break-glass lets on-call raise sampling to 100% for one hour, bypassing the config freeze. Use sparingly; each use is reviewed at the weekly sync. To activate, enter the break-glass passphrase below.

recovery phrase for tawig-fahof: noveth-julax-gorius-raldor-zordor-ralix-rusix-gileth-julok

Night crew: visitors to the Fernwick prototype workshop after 21:00 need a Marlowe-badged escort at all times — no exceptions, even for quick drop-offs. Keep guests clear of the mill benches and the resin station, and make sure they sign the late log by the tool crib. If your escort badge doesn't open the workshop shutter, use the keypad beside it with the code below.

badge for hahif-faweg: bdg-VF-9

## Runbook 4.2 — Account Recovery During Queue Migration

While we replace the homegrown Brindle job queue with Relayline, account-recovery jobs are dual-written to both systems. Release manager: before cutover, confirm the Relayline consumer has drained the backlog and that no recovery emails are duplicated. If the legacy queue must be re-enabled, the admin console requires elevated access; authenticate with the recovery passphrase noted below.

vault phrase of bagaf-kajeg = jorath-feniel-briir-siliel-ralix

## Deployment

Schemaforge deploys via the standard Brindle pipeline. Tag a release, let CI build the registry image, and promote it through staging to prod. Compatibility checks run automatically; a failed check blocks promotion. Rollbacks are a single re-tag. Before promoting, confirm the prod instance picks up the expected settings. The current production deployment uses these configuration values.

settings of yageg-yahap:
[gorael]
team = olieth
access_code = ac_941d74
owner = brieth.aldiel
host = gorael.tolvaqio.internal
port = 6379
peer = briwyn.urlaqtech.internal
salt = 116e6622
pin = 1957